Scott v. Wal-Mart Stores, Inc.
Plaintiff: Bonnie Scott
Defendant: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. and Wal-Mart Stores East, LP
Case Number: 3:2019cv00574
Filed: August 16, 2019
Court: US District Court for the Southern District of Mississippi
Presiding Judge: F Keith Ball
Referring Judge: Carlton W Reeves
Nature of Suit: P.I.: Other
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1441
Jury Demanded By: Both

Date Filed Document Text
October 10, 2019 RESET Hearing: Telephonic Case Management Conference reset for 10/18/2019 03:00 PM before Magistrate Judge F. Keith Ball. (JEJ)
October 7,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 6 AGREED ORDER Substituting Wal-Mart Stores East, L.P. as Defendant and Dismissing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. from This Cause. Signed by Magistrate Judge F. Keith Ball on 10/7/2019. (dcw)
October 4, 2019 Filing 5 NOTICE of Service of Pre-Discovery Disclosure by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. (Smith, Dorissa)
August 27, 2019 Filing 4 State Court Record by Defendant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. (Smith, Dorissa)
August 22, 2019 Filing 3 Rule 16(a) Initial Order Telephonic Case Management Conference set for 10/11/2019 11:00 AM before Magistrate Judge F. Keith Ball. No later than seven (7) days prior to the TCMC, a confidential memorandum AND a proposed Case Management Order shall be submitted via e mail to ball_chambers@mssd.uscourts.gov. Counsel for Plaintiff shall set up the conference and, once all the parties are on the line, contact the Court at 601-608-4460. (JEJ)
August 20, 2019 Filing 2 NOTICE of Appearance by Thomas M. Louis on behalf of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. (Louis, Thomas)
August 16, 2019 Filing 1 NOTICE OF REMOVAL by Wal-Mart Stores, Inc. from Circuit Court of Madison County, MS, case number CI2019-0130. ( Filing fee $ 400 receipt number 0538-4062600) If the complete state court record is not attached as an Exhibit to the Petition for Removal, pursuant to Rule L.U.Civ.R. 5(b): within 14 days removing party must electronically file the entire state court record as a single filing; and all parties shall, within fourteen days after the Case Management Conference, file as separate docket items any unresolved motions that were filed in state court which they wish to advance. (Attachments: #1 Exhibit A - Complaint, #2 Exhibit B - PL RFA Responses, #3 Exhibit C - PL's Responses to WM's Interrogatories, #4 Exhibit D - NOS PL RFA Responses, #5 Exhibit E - NOS - PL Responses to INT - RFP, #6 Exhibit F - Copies of process pleadings etc. served on WM, #7 Civil Cover Sheet)(KNS)
